@mandrews78 not every flight you book will be eligible to be put on hold. If it is eligible, you would see it on the screen you provided under the Finalize and Cancel trip options. Whether a trip is eligible or not is determined by supplier support.

Even though "hold" is not an official option. As long as you have a record locator, it will likely still be held until the time limit shown, if you were to just ignore....  You might get some email about you having an incomplete trip that you should come back and finalize if you want the ticket.
